網頁2024年3月31日 · A goal of 10,000 steps a day is commonly cited, but recent studies have shown that health benefits accrue even if fewer than 10,000 steps are taken daily. Past studies have mostly been done in older adults. It hasn’t been clear what number of steps or intensity are needed to benefit adults of other ages. If you are already living a smoke-free life, you’re … directcourse 60 hour online training walk網頁How much: Ideally, at least 30 minutes a day, at least five days a week. Examples: Brisk walking, running, swimming, cycling, playing tennis and jumping rope. Heart-pumping aerobic exercise is the kind that doctors have in mind when they recommend at least 150 minutes per week of moderate activity. direct cover status for requirement in alm
